India Advised to Prioritize Smaller, Efficient AI Models Over Competing in LLM Race
Importance: 80/1001 Sources
Why It Matters
This recommendation from a prominent industry leader provides a strategic alternative for India's AI development, potentially allowing it to build a unique and impactful AI ecosystem without engaging in a resource-intensive LLM competition.
Key Intelligence
- ■Zoho CEO Sridhar Vembu suggests India should not aim to compete with global tech giants in developing large language models (LLMs).
- ■Instead, he recommends India focus on building smaller, more efficient, and specialized AI models.
- ■This strategy would enable India to create tailored AI solutions for its specific needs, linguistic diversity, and local contexts.
